The Queshtarii are a collection of tribes that inhabit the eastern regions of Pashdun. They have small settlements based around oasis within the Pashdun. The primary export is Qesh, a hallucinogenic drug, sold in bricks of dried fibers from the roots of the plant. The tribes are ruled by semi-hereditary chieftans. The Queshtarii have some of few horses on the planet that can stand camels, and routinely field armies with both. Strangely pure blooded Queshtarii cannot wield arcane magic, including from scrolls or wands, ect. This along with the lack of any viable economy in the desert, lead to frequent raids by the tribes into civilized lands that border on the Pashdun both to steal food, and to gain the services of those with arcane abilities. The Queshtarii will pay virtually any sum for slaves that have arcane training. Queshtarii armies are composed of lightly armoured raiders equipped with javalins, spears, and composite short bows and mounted on horses and camels.
Normally strangers are not allowed through tribal lands without significant “gifts” and the sands are stained with the blood of those who thought they had not been detected. But if one shows arcane gifts and no foul intentions they are welcomed. It is for this reason that Queshtar has a significant amount of wizard towers, or just wizards living in ancient ruins, ect, as there are few around to hinder their research and tests. These wizards are a significant source of coin to the tribes as few wizards will take time out of their experiments to collect supplies, reagents or test subjects. It is said that if one has the coin and knowledge of location that one could find a wizard capable of binding transmuting spells to one’s flesh permanently.
The Queshtarii are monotheistic worshiping only the god Akran and his avatar magno solis, the great sun. It is said that long ago many were their gods until the great chieftan, Hortan was blessed with a vision of Akran standing alone above mortals. He poured his favor into the Akrany cult, eventually outlawing all others and taking the name Akratan. His wars of faith with the other tribes lasted a score of years and left countless dead including the priests of the other cults.
